The Finance Velocity Office at Visa is designed to accelerate our path to building a world-class finance function, shape our transformation strategy, improve our business operations and enhance the impact we make as an organization. Why Velocity? Velocity is about both speed and strategy, focused on accelerating in a given direction. We will hone our approach, think big and decide quickly, living our Leadership Principles. This dedicated team drives global consistency to operate as one team to:
The Director Finance Transformation Project Manager will join the Finance Velocity Office to manage high impact projects across the organization, advancing the tools and methodology to build and design capabilities. The right candidate has experience building detailed project plans, facilitating discussions/ meetings to drive accountability, developing stakeholder maps and engagement plans, creating tracking dashboards, using best in class Project Management tools and playbooks.
